Monday, October 4th, 2010If you are planning to purchase a car but your finances are restricted, then the best spot where you could potentially purchase one is through an auction for salvage cars. For anyone who is not very knowledgeable about the actual automobile of your choice, ask folks that may be of help to you in trying to find your ideal car. While these cars usually are not as poor in quality as the vast majority of folks think, it is still crucial for you to take a careful look at them prior to placing a bid. Look beyond the appearance, and perform a detailed check on the motors, brake systems and clutches before making a choice. Each consumer has to be seen as a competitor when it comes to buying a car from these car auctions. Everybody wants to achieve the best buy possible. Do not believe everything that you are told. In salvage auto auction locations, every person is out to make the best of what they can get; the auctioneer included. Despite the fact that the auctioneer will stop short at nothing in projecting every automobile in good light, a smart bidder will certainly take a look at each department of an automobile. You want the very best at the most affordable bid, while the auctioneer wants his earnings maximized. At auctions for these salvage cars, recognize where your strength lies, and avoid extending above your financial means. Just because a vehicle may be badly wrecked doesn’t mean that it has a inadequate motor. Bringing a skilled mechanic with you is a great benefit. The more unsightly a car looks, the fewer amounts of people will be paying attention to it. The quality of an expert bidder is the power to maintain his / her composure whenever possible. Do not allow the occasion to overpower you, and be as calm as you can be. Be well articulated and resist every temptation to go beyond your specific budget. Always look at the effects of each and every bid you intend to make before you ultimately commit yourself to it. Avoid paying more than what you should spend when you go to salvage car auctions. Once you’ve chosen the automobile that matches your requirements and wants, then it is time to visit to the auction place to look at the automobile the day prior to the bidding date. Salvage cars do not cost very much, although replacement parts might be costly.
